Abstract
This paper presents real time fractional-order control technique for a coupled tank liquid level system that often used in industry. First of all system dynamic model has been presented. And then two different control approaches such as the classical proportional-integral-derivative (PID) and fractional-order PI lambda D mu control are used to improve the tracking performance of the coupled tank liquid level system. Design procedures for both controllers are given in detail. Additionally, to verify the effectiveness of the fractional-order PID controller, detailed experimental comparisons with a feedforward proportional integral controller has been realized. It is observed that not only transient but also steady-state error values have been reduced with the aid of the PI lambda D mu controller for tracking control purpose. (C) 2017 The Authors.
